CHAPTER 1: QI YUAN

Canglan World. Divine Radiance Sect.

The sound of the morning bell rang continuously, waking all the disciples. They were full of spirit as they started circulating and refining their qi. The sounds of morning practice echoed throughout the sect. It was full of vitality.

On the Seven-Colored Peak, Qi Yuan lay in bed. The sound of the morning bell was particularly piercing. He covered his ears.

The wooden cat puppet then opened its mouth and called out, “Wake up! Wake up!”

Qi Yuan waved his hand and stuffed a small wooden fish into the wooden cat puppet's mouth, effectively silencing it.

He shifted in bed and continued to sleep comfortably.

The sun is high up in the sky and I continue to sleep. Who is the immortal? I am the immortal!

An unknown amount of time passed before Qi Yuan slowly woke up.

He took a deep breath. "Hmm, the air of this world is quite fresh."

The reason he was talking as if he wasn’t really from this world was that... he really wasn’t. He had transmigrated to this world half a year back, and he was originally from another world known as the Blue Planet.

Unlike the Blue Planet, this world had supernatural things and immortal cultivators.

By a twist of fate, Qi Yuan joined the Divine Radiance Sect and became a disciple of the Seven-Colored Peak, one of the sect’s five peaks. The only disciple of the Seven-Colored Peak, to be more specific.

After washing up and changing his clothes, Qi Yuan got up and left his hut. Yesterday, his master had sent him a message, instructing him to do several things.

Qi Yuan was standing at the midpoint of a mountain as he looked toward the peak. The peak towered into the clouds, filled with ethereal immortal energy.

Qi Yuan looked at the palace amidst the clouds and murmured, "Another day without Master."

The clouds atop the peak suddenly rippled, then dissipated in an instant, as if nothing had happened.

His master lived at the summit, but there was a restriction in place; Qi Yuan was not allowed to go up. Unaware of the clouds gathering and dispersing above, Qi Yuan began descending the Seven-Colored Peak.

Today, the Divine Radiance Sect was recruiting new disciples. He was to represent the Seven-Colored Peak, to recruit new disciples.

The vast Seven-Colored Peak had only him, an unpromising disciple, and the sect members had some opinions about this.

Of course, the Seven-Colored Peak’s Peak Master was powerful, so they kept their opinions to themselves. It was just that now, even the Peak Master had an issue with Qi Yuan. Hence, they were to recruit more disciples.

Qi Yuan slowly made his way down the Seven-Colored Peak.

Halfway down the mountain, Qi Yuan paused under a huge tree towering many zhang tall. From there, he glanced at a tender, green blade of grass on the ground, and a string of text floated in his mind.

[This is not an ordinary blade of grass. Three days ago, Lord Withered Tree had a rendezvous with the Great Shang Queen on it.]

He was momentarily stunned. If he remembered correctly, a few days ago when he passed by here, what he saw was something else entirely.

[This is an ordinary blade of grass. Four days ago, a stray dog peed on it.]

"This blade of grass is quite interesting."

After starting to cultivate Qi, Qi Yuan realized that there was something going on with his eyes. He could see things that others could not.

For example, when he first set eyes on the cultivation manual that his master gave him, the Seven-Colored Flame Refinement Sutra. What he saw was...

[This is a Jade-tier cultivation technique. There are 1371 glaring flaws within it and numerous minor ones. If cultivated to the Supreme Realm, you will become food for an unnamable existence.]

When Qi Yuan saw this, he froze. He then went to look at other cultivation manuals. They were more or less the same.

Supreme Realm?

Food?

Isn't it too far away?

It was not something a small Qi Refinement cultivator like him should consider. But of course, his cultivation was also stuck at the Qi Refinement Realm.

Because according to what he could see, he would officially become food the moment he made a breakthrough.

Hence, Qi Yuan had been working hard to look for a suitable cultivation manual.

At the sect’s main hall, divine light radiated everywhere. The white-haired Kang Fulu held a horsetail whisk and sat floating in mid-air.

Behind him, the senior disciples of the other peaks stood tall and straight.

Kang Fulu looked at the hundreds of newly admitted disciples below and appeared satisfied. However, he then recalled something and asked slowly, “Has the representative from the Seven-Colored Peak not arrived yet?”

"Senior Brother Kang, you know the personality of the Senior from the Seven-Colored Peak...” a man in golden robes replied softly.

Kang Fulu said nothing else.

Just then, a voice rang out, “Senior Qi Yuan from the Seven-Colored Peak has arrived.”

Qi Yuan appeared before the crowd in his white robes, with a jade pendant at his waist. His stature appeared tall and proud as he walked toward the light.

Several Divine Radiance Sect disciples as well as the newly admitted disciples turned to look at Qi Yuan.

"I never thought Senior Qi Yuan would actually come down the mountain!"

"He is... better looking than the rumors made him out to be."

"What a pity, such a beautiful man, yet..."

"Yet?"

"He behaves so strangely. There must be something wrong with his brain!"

"Huh?"

"Actually, not exactly. It is just that the way he cultivates is unlike normal people. His cultivation path is Obsession. Cultivators of this path all have unique personalities."

"A mental case? Better not mess with him."

"Though he seems crazy, he is actually really talented and has a lot of insights in cultivation. Several senior brothers and sisters have consulted him on cultivation methods."

The cultivators whispered amongst themselves and several of them looked at Qi Yuan with odd expressions.

In the Canglan World, there were three types of people you don't mess with.

Firstly, healers. Secondly, swordsmen. Last of all, Obsession cultivators.

Healers were masters of medicine and could heal people. All cultivators were at risk of getting injured and would need healers to speed up their recovery. Hence, they could not afford to mess with healers. Plus, many healers were also skilled with poisons, both deadly and invisible. It was best not to offend them.

The battle prowess of swordsmen was astounding, and they were ruthless. If one could avoid them, one should avoid them.

As for Obsession cultivators, they were a completely different breed. This type of cultivators fixated on one thing to the point of obsession. It could be a sword, a flower, or even a person.

Their extreme obsession often hinted at mental instability. It was better to avoid them as it was difficult to tell when they would lose control.

Qi Yuan was an Obsession cultivator.

"Junior Brother Qi Yuan, you are a little late," Kang Fulu said softly.

Qi Yuan yawned. "I slept late last night."

The senior disciples of the other peaks did not say anything more.

Kang Fulu announced, "Since everyone is here, let's start with the recruitment."

The square was filled with new disciples who had just passed the entrance trials.

The senior disciples of each peak were responsible for selecting new members into their respective peaks.

Kang Fulu stepped forward and looked over the hundreds of new disciples, speaking slowly, “The Divine Radiance Sect is one of the three Great Immortal Sects of the Great Shang Kingdom. Congratulations to all of you. Having passed rigorous trials, you are now officially disciples of the Divine Radiance Sect.”

Upon hearing this, the hundreds of young boys and girls present looked excited.

After all, the Divine Radiance Sect was one of the three strongest sects in the Great Shang Kingdom. It was extremely prestigious to be part of a sect like this.

Kang Fulu was satisfied with the reaction of the crowd and continued, "There are a total of five peaks in Divine Radiance Sect, you may choose to join one peak."

“This is Zhuge Miao, senior disciple of the Divine Medicine Peak.”

“This is Xu Yiyi, senior disciple of the Myriad Arts Peak.”

“This is Qi Yuan, senior disciple of the Seven-Colored Peak.”

“This is Madman, senior disciple of the Battle Peak.”

“I am Kang Fulu, personal disciple of the Five-Light Peak’s Peak Master, son-in-law of the Divine Radiance Sect's Sect Master, compiler of the Five-Light Saint Arts, creator of the Little Sun Technique, and Chief Senior Disciple of the Five-Light Peak.”

As he spoke, divine lights of five different colours appeared above Kang Fulu’s head, making him look brilliant and eye-catching.

That’s right. This was Kang Fulu, also known as the flashiest show-off of the Five-Light Peak.
